What is a Damper Actuator?

A damper actuator is an essential device in HVAC systems that automates the control of air dampers, regulating the airflow within ventilation ducts. It works by adjusting the position of the damper blades to either open or close, allowing for precise control of air distribution. This level of control is critical for maintaining air quality, temperature consistency, and energy efficiency within a building. Damper actuators can be operated using electric, pneumatic, or hydraulic power sources, depending on the design of the HVAC system. The Rise of ODM Manufacturers Original Design Manufacturers (ODMs) have become an integral part of the HVAC industry, especially in the production of specialized components like damper actuators. Unlike traditional Original Equipment Manufacturers (OEMs), ODM manufacturers are responsible for designing, developing, and customizing products based on the specific requirements of their clients. This means businesses can get damper actuators that are tailored to their exact specifications, whether it’s for a new HVAC system or to upgrade an existing one.
